Group Employer Based Insurance
Blue Cross Blue Shield offers a preferred provider organization (PPO) that lets members choose their own doctors, hospitals and specialists. Your employees have two options after meeting the annual deductible:
- In network the member pays the selected coinsurance amount and BlueCross pays the allowed difference. Example, member pays 20% coinsurance, BlueCross pays the 80% balance.
- Out of network the member pays the selected coinsurance amount and BlueCross pays allowed difference. Example, member pays 40% coinsurance, BlueCross pays the 60% balance.
Network doctors file claims electronically for members, saving your employee the time and hassle of claim filing.
Employees have access to their personal online account by registering with My Insurance Manager at www.SouthCarolinaBlues.com. They can then view claims status, explanations of benefits, check eligibility, read benefits and coverage information, verify authorization status for inpatient and outpatient visits and check their deductibles and out-of-pocket status. They can ask questions via e-mail, request new ID cards, and more.

Short Term Major Medical Insurance
When you find yourself in a position that leaves you without health insurance, whether starting a new job, between jobs, whatever the reason this is the coverage for you. Going without health insurance puts you at grave financial risk. This policy, aptly named Short-term insurance offers you temporary health coverage. You select from the following:
- Coverage terms of 30, 60, 90, 120, 150, or 180 days
- Choice of deductible
If you are between the age of 1 and 65, not pregnant, a South Carolina resident and U.S. citizen and have not been turned down for health insurance coverage within the last five years and currently are not covered by any other healthcare policy you can pay a one time premium and have peace of mind. Disability Insurance
When faced with a life's crisis, as we all are at one time or another it is comforting to know that our income is safe. That allows us the time to deal with our crisis without losing all that we have worked for.
Disability insurance can be employer based or purchased as a stand alone product. Either way monthly benefits are paid directly to you allowing you to continue to live in the style you have become accustomed to while dealing with life's crisis. Employee Benefit Packages
In today's market place employee retention is paramount to success, and hiring the most qualified person usually involves an enticing benefits package. Offering group health insurance along with a package of supplemental benefits gives your company a professional advantage.
You the employer can redistribute the cost of providing supplemental benefits using payroll deduction, shifting this cost from you to your employees. The employees welcome the benefits and appreciate the ability to voluntarily select the products that best fit their needs.
Employees select from a pre-determined array of products; life insurance, cancer and dreaded disease insurance, short and long term disability, hospital indemnity insurance and more.
